Roofing Company Near You: 4 Documents to Compare

Three roofing estimates are spread across the kitchen counter. One is thousands less than the others. One looks polished but says very little. One mentions permits, flashing details, and possible plywood replacement if damage shows up during tear-off. At that moment, the real problem is not choosing a number. It is figuring out whether these companies are even pricing the same roof.

We walk homeowners through this kind of decision by treating the estimate as an accountability document, not just a price sheet. If two nearby roofing companies describe different inspections, different scope assumptions, different permit responsibilities, and different warranty language, then the cheaper bid may simply be omitting risk. Before you compare dollars, you need to compare what each contractor is actually taking responsibility for.

A homeowner comparing multiple roofing estimates and paperwork spread across a kitchen table.
Need a clearer way to compare bids?
Get a roofing assessment from a team that explains scope, permits, and warranty responsibility up front.
If you are reviewing multiple estimates, EcoStar can help you understand what is actually included, where hidden risk may exist, and who is truly prepared to own the project from inspection through final sign-off.

In Southern California, roof work on older homes often carries variables that do not show up in a headline total. Ventilation may need correction. Flashing details around penetrations or wall intersections may be weak. Underlayment choices may differ. A permit may trigger code-related work or municipal inspection steps. Once tear-off begins, damaged sheathing can change the scope. If one contractor built those realities into the job and another glossed over them, the estimates are not truly competing.

That is why we do not advise homeowners to start with price alone. In Los Angeles, Orange County, Riverside, Inglewood, and similar markets, the safer comparison is scope first, price second. A bid that looks attractively simple can become expensive later if important items reappear as change orders, delays, or arguments about who was supposed to handle what.

There is also a practical household issue here. Most families do not want to manage a roofing project like a part-time job. They want a contractor who can explain the problem clearly, document the work thoroughly, handle permits and inspections properly, and still stand behind the installation after the crew leaves. That kind of ownership usually shows up in the paperwork before it shows up on the roof.

If the diagnosis is weak, the estimate built on top of it is weak too. We encourage homeowners to ask a simple question first: what exactly did this company observe, and did they explain why they are recommending repair or replacement? A trustworthy inspection should do more than announce that the roof is old or leaking. It should connect visible conditions to the proposed solution.

At a minimum, the inspection narrative should identify the roof type, age if known, leak-related symptoms, visible wear patterns, trouble spots around flashing or penetrations, ventilation concerns if relevant, and any signs that hidden substrate damage may be possible. If the home is older, the report should show some awareness that deck condition, fastening details, and code-triggered corrections may become part of the job. We are not looking for theatrics. We are looking for a contractor who can tell the story of the roof in writing.

When estimates vary widely, this is often where the split begins. One company may have inspected carefully and documented likely problem areas. Another may have delivered a fast price based mostly on square footage and surface appearance. Those are not equal levels of preparation. The second bid can look convenient, but it leaves more room for surprises later.

A roofing professional inspecting a residential roof and documenting conditions.

Read the written scope like a project owner

Once the inspection makes sense, the next question is whether the written scope actually matches it. This is where many homeowners get trapped by vague language. If the report mentions flashing issues, ventilation concerns, or probable deck damage, the scope should tell you how those items will be addressed, or at least how they will be evaluated and priced if discovered after tear-off.

A solid roofing scope usually explains the tear-off plan, disposal, underlayment, flashing treatment, penetrations, ventilation-related work if applicable, replacement assumptions, jobsite protection, cleanup expectations, and whether permit and inspection coordination are included. It does not need to read like an engineering manual, but it should be specific enough that you can tell what work is inside the contract and what is not.

Vague terms such as “replace roof as needed” or “standard flashing” are where friction starts. Standard according to whom? As needed based on what condition? If the contractor cannot define the work before signing, the homeowner often ends up discovering the real scope after the old roof is already off. That is not a strong negotiating position.

We tell homeowners to compare bids line by line and look for omissions, not just upgrades. A higher estimate may include real work that a lower bid left out. Better documentation can make a contractor appear more expensive on paper when they are really just being more honest about the full job.

Permits are not a side detail; they are a responsibility test

Permits sound administrative until something goes wrong. Then they become a direct measure of who is owning the project. Homeowners should know exactly who is pulling the permit, who is scheduling inspections, who is responding to corrections if the city asks for changes, and who is carrying the job through final sign-off.

In roofing, especially in Southern California, code compliance is not a decorative issue. Permit requirements can affect installation details, documentation, and inspection timing. If a company seems casual or evasive about permitting, that is usually not a small paperwork quirk. It may signal loose project ownership overall.

A dependable contractor should be able to explain the permit path in plain language. If the permit is required, they should tell you whether it is included, who files it, what inspections are expected, and how corrections are handled. Homeowners should be cautious when a company pushes permit responsibility back onto them or treats final inspection as someone else’s problem. Those gray areas are exactly where delays and finger-pointing start.

At EcoStar, this is part of the value of a full-service model. When one team helps carry the project from diagnosis through permits, construction, inspections, and closeout, there is less room for the homeowner to get stuck between disconnected responsibilities.

Permit and contractor paperwork related to a residential roofing project.

Hidden damage should be anticipated, not used as an excuse for chaos

One of the hardest parts of roofing is that some conditions cannot be fully confirmed until tear-off begins. Damaged sheathing, attachment issues, or concealed moisture problems may only become visible once the old roofing material is removed. That does not mean every surprise is avoidable. It does mean the contractor should have a process for handling surprises without turning the project into a dispute.

We look for estimate language that sets expectations early. Does the contractor explain that deck replacement, if needed, will be documented and approved through a change-order process? Do they describe how hidden damage will be communicated, priced, and authorized? Do they acknowledge the possibility in a calm, transparent way instead of acting as if no hidden condition could ever exist?

The key distinction is whether hidden damage is framed as a managed risk or an open-ended loophole. Responsible companies do not promise a zero-surprise world on an older roof. They explain what can be known before work starts, what may only be known after tear-off, and how decisions will be handled if new conditions appear. That protects the homeowner from both false confidence and needless panic.

Warranty language tells you who expects to hear from you again

Many homeowners hear “warranty” and assume all coverage means the same thing. It does not. Manufacturer coverage generally relates to the roofing materials themselves. Workmanship coverage relates to how the roof was installed. Those are different responsibilities, and the difference matters.

If a proposal leans heavily on manufacturer warranty language but says little about the contractor’s own workmanship responsibility, we would slow down. Material coverage can be important, but it does not replace accountability for installation quality, flashing execution, weatherproofing details, or follow-through if a problem shows up after completion.

That is why we advise homeowners to ask how long the contractor backs their workmanship, what that warranty covers, and how service calls are handled. Clear workmanship language is often a strong signal that the company expects to stand behind the install, not just hand you product paperwork. EcoStar’s 2-year workmanship warranty reflects that kind of post-install accountability. It is not just about saying the right thing at signing; it is about still owning the roof after installation is complete.

What to confirm before choosing a roofing company

  • A written inspection report or clear inspection narrative that explains why repair or replacement is being recommended.
  • A scope of work that matches that diagnosis and spells out tear-off, underlayment, flashing, ventilation-related items if relevant, cleanup, and disposal.
  • Clear permit responsibility, including who pulls permits, schedules inspections, and responds to corrections.
  • A documented process for hidden sheathing or deck damage, including how discoveries are approved and priced.
  • Separate explanation of manufacturer material coverage versus contractor workmanship coverage.
  • Written change-order expectations so you know how scope changes will be communicated before extra work proceeds.

How vague bids create friction and full-service accountability reduces it

Imagine two roof bids on the same older home. The lower one gives a brief description, no meaningful inspection narrative, and broad language about replacing roofing materials. The other explains likely trouble spots, includes permit coordination, outlines flashing and underlayment details, and states how hidden deck damage would be documented if discovered. The first number may look better for a week. The second usually looks better once the project gets real.

In the first scenario, tear-off begins and damaged sheathing appears near a leak area. The homeowner is suddenly asked to approve extra costs with little context. Then a permit issue or inspection correction surfaces, and it is unclear who owns the next step. Meanwhile, everyone starts using the phrase “that was not included.” The low bid has become a stress multiplier.

In the second scenario, the homeowner may still face a legitimate hidden-damage change, but the framework is already in place. The contractor documents the finding, explains the fix, prices it clearly, and continues through permit and inspection requirements without handing administrative confusion back to the family. That is what end-to-end accountability looks like in practice. For busy households, it is often worth far more than the initial gap between two estimate totals.

Common mistakes that make roof estimates look easier to compare than they are

Comparing totals before matching scope is the biggest one. If one company included permit handling, detailed flashing work, and realistic hidden-damage planning while another did not, the prices are not describing the same commitment.

Assuming all warranties protect you equally is another. A long material warranty can sound reassuring while leaving workmanship responsibility blurry. If installation accountability is weak, the most impressive product language may not help much when the issue is execution.

Treating permit responsibility as optional admin also creates risk. Roofing projects move more smoothly when one contractor clearly owns approvals, inspections, and correction responses instead of leaving gray areas for the homeowner to sort out.

And finally, letting urgency force a shallow review can be costly. A leak or failed inspection can make any fast answer feel attractive. But a rushed signature on a vague proposal often creates the very delays and disputes homeowners were trying to avoid.

Frequently asked questions

How can I tell whether a roofer is pushing replacement when a repair might work?

Ask the company to justify the recommendation in writing. A credible inspection should explain the roof’s current condition, where failures are occurring, whether the problem appears isolated or system-wide, and why a repair would or would not be dependable. If the recommendation is replacement, the report should make that case with observations, not just age-based generalities.

What happens if hidden sheathing damage is found after tear-off?

That condition should be documented and handled through a clear change-order process. The important thing is not whether hidden damage is possible; it often is on older roofs. The important thing is whether the contractor explained that risk in advance, defined how discoveries would be priced and approved, and communicated the finding before proceeding.

Do permits make a roofing project take much longer?

Permits can affect scheduling, but they also create a cleaner path for compliance and final sign-off. A well-organized contractor should be able to explain the likely timeline, who is handling submissions, when inspections are expected, and how any corrections would be addressed. The better question is not whether permits add steps, but whether your contractor is equipped to own those steps without creating confusion for you.

Who should be responsible for the final inspection?

The contractor should be. Homeowners should not be left to coordinate final inspection logistics or interpret correction notices on their own. If a roofing company is truly taking responsibility for the job, they should carry it through to final inspection and address any required follow-up as part of that process.

When several local roofers look similar at first glance, the safest way forward is to slow the comparison down and test the paperwork. Match the inspection to the scope, match the scope to the permit path, match the permit path to the change-order process, and match all of that to a real workmanship commitment. That is usually where the difference appears between a company selling a roof and a company taking ownership of the whole project. For homeowners who want less gray area and more accountability from first inspection through final sign-off, EcoStar is built for exactly that kind of job.

Choose a roofing contractor with full-service accountability.
From inspection and written scope to permits, construction, inspections, and closeout, EcoStar helps Southern California homeowners move forward with less gray area and more confidence. Reach out to discuss your roof and next steps.

Book a Roofing Consultation

EcoStar Remodeling & Construction

EcoStar Remodeling & Construction has been delivering trusted, high-quality home renovations since 2010. From kitchens to full home remodels, we bring craftsmanship, care, and lasting value to every project.

Opening Hours

Main Headquarters in
Los angeles

Dallas Office

Bay Office

Seattle Office

Opening Hours

Monday – Thursday8:00AM – 7:00PM
Friday:8:00AM – 2:30PM
Saturday:Closed
Sunday:8:00AM – 7:00PM